Quick Steps to Delete Games

Deleting games on your Nintendo Switch is a straightforward process. First, navigate to the Home screen. Then, select the game you wish to delete and press the ‘+’ or ‘-‘ button on your controller. Choose ‘Manage Software’ and then ‘Delete Software’. Confirm your choice, and voilà, the game is gone!

This process not only frees up space but also helps you keep your library organized. If you ever want to play the game again, you can re-download it from the Nintendo eShop as long as you’re using the same Nintendo account.
